Hi,
How does one set texture, normal texture and a 3rd texture for a material in bforartists2? I knew how to do it in version 1 and in Blender but I cannot find the material options anymore in version 2 to set the textures from image files.
note: I use the blender engine. It is for 3d models that I want to import later in a game engine.
Thanks
Hi Ochanz,
This is done by nodes only now. This part is not different from Bforartists 1 and old Blender 2.79 with Cycles renderer. But a bit more tricky than the old BI materials.
Switch to shading tab with your object. Add a material to your object if you haven’t already. In the Properties editor have a look for the Materials Library VX panel. Here you can find lots of useful examples. I would start with the Basic library. And add a few materials from there by simply clicking at the Apply button.

Actually you can also modify all material settings and the textures in the material roll out on the right in list format. – The node editor is more visual and easier to understand for complex materials, but I often use the list view for some quick modifications without the need to go to the node editor. – Just click on the small square next to the different material parametes and a menu pops up with all the possible options for this slot.
